EVERYBODY'S PICTURES.

MARY PICKKORD TONTGHT. A Paramount super-feature, re-loaned tlirougli the Art Craft Picture Corporation, of Mary Pickford is the ■chief, forms the attraction at Everybody'* Pitcino Theatre tonight. The world's sweetheart is seen in a new role, as a. lEttlo Dutch girl in "Hukta from Holland." The story is a very pathetic one but abounds with .smiles, then teaiv, and the pretty romance is ihappily ended. The prices are, the same viz., Is adults, ch'ildren (id and no' war tax is addied. 'Hie programme is to be repeated on WccTuesdiiy. The box plan is at Aitken's and no extra for booking is charged.
